1.1 Understanding the OBD2 ELM327 Adapter

The ELM327 is a microcontroller programmed to translate the OBD-II vehicle interface to a serial interface. It allows devices to communicate with a vehicle’s computer. According to a study by the Society of Automotive Engineers (SAE), OBD-II standardization began in 1996 in the United States to monitor emissions-related components.

1.2 The Role of the PIN Code in Pairing

The PIN code is used to securely pair your device (smartphone, tablet, etc.) with the ELM327 adapter via Bluetooth. Without proper pairing, you won’t be able to establish a connection and access the diagnostic data.

3. Identifying the Correct OBD2 ELM327 Pin Code

Finding the correct PIN code is crucial for successfully pairing your device with the ELM327 adapter. A wrong PIN will prevent the connection, making the adapter unusable.

3.1 Checking the Adapter Documentation

The most reliable place to find the PIN code is in the documentation that came with your ELM327 adapter. This could be a physical manual or a digital document. Look for sections on Bluetooth pairing or setup instructions.

3.2 Common Default PIN Codes

Many ELM327 adapters use default PIN codes. Try these common PINs:

  • 1234
  • 0000
  • 7890
  • 1111

4. Step-by-Step Guide to Pairing Your Device Using the OBD2 ELM327 Pin

Pairing your device with the OBD2 ELM327 adapter involves a few straightforward steps. This process typically involves enabling Bluetooth on your device, locating the adapter, and entering the correct PIN code. Here’s how to do it:

4.1 Preparing Your Vehicle and Adapter

  1. Locate the OBD2 Port: Usually found under the dashboard on the driver’s side.
  2. Plug in the Adapter: Ensure it’s securely connected.
  3. Turn on Ignition: Turn the key to the “ON” position without starting the engine.

4.2 Pairing on Android Devices

  1. Enable Bluetooth: Go to Settings > Bluetooth and turn it on.

  2. Scan for Devices: Your device will search for available Bluetooth devices.

  3. Select Your Adapter: It will likely appear as “OBDII”, “OBD2”, or the adapter’s brand name (e.g., “Viecar”).

  4. Enter the PIN: When prompted, enter the PIN code (e.g., 1234, 0000).

4.3 Pairing on iOS Devices (iPhone/iPad)

  1. Enable Bluetooth: Go to Settings > Bluetooth and turn it on.
  2. App Pairing: iOS devices typically pair via the OBD2 app, not directly through Bluetooth settings.
  3. Select Adapter in App: Open your chosen OBD2 app and select the adapter from the device list within the app settings.

4.4 Troubleshooting Pairing Issues

  • Incorrect PIN: Double-check the PIN from the documentation or try common default codes.
  • Adapter Not Discoverable: Ensure the adapter has power and is within Bluetooth range.
  • Bluetooth Issues: Restart your device or reset Bluetooth settings.
  • App Compatibility: Make sure the app supports your adapter and device.

7. Advanced Diagnostics and Troubleshooting with OBD2 ELM327

Beyond basic error code reading, OBD2 ELM327 adapters can be used for advanced diagnostics and troubleshooting. This involves understanding various diagnostic parameters and interpreting the data to identify underlying issues.

7.1 Reading and Interpreting Diagnostic Trouble Codes (DTCs)

DTCs are codes stored in your car’s computer when a problem is detected. Understanding these codes is the first step in diagnosing issues.

  • P-Codes: Powertrain (engine, transmission)
  • B-Codes: Body (airbags, central locking)
  • C-Codes: Chassis (ABS, suspension)
  • U-Codes: Network (communication)

7.2 Live Data Monitoring for In-Depth Analysis

Live data monitoring allows you to observe various parameters in real-time as your car is running. This can help you identify intermittent issues or pinpoint the source of a problem.

  • Engine Temperature
  • Oxygen Sensor Readings
  • Fuel Trim
  • Mass Airflow (MAF)
  • RPM

7.3 Performing Advanced Tests and Procedures

Some OBD2 apps and tools offer advanced tests and procedures, such as:

  • Actuator Tests: Control various components to verify their functionality.
  • Readiness Tests: Check if your car is ready for emissions testing.
  • Freeze Frame Data: Capture data at the moment a DTC was triggered.

7.4 Using Freeze Frame Data

Freeze frame data captures the engine parameters at the moment a Diagnostic Trouble Code (DTC) is triggered. This snapshot provides valuable clues about the conditions that led to the fault. Analyzing freeze frame data can help technicians and car owners diagnose intermittent issues more effectively by understanding what was happening with the engine when the problem occurred.

11. How to Choose the Right OBD2 ELM327 Adapter

Selecting the right OBD2 ELM327 adapter is crucial for effective vehicle diagnostics and customization. With numerous options available, understanding the key features, compatibility, and reliability factors will help you make an informed decision.

11.1 Key Features to Consider

When choosing an OBD2 ELM327 adapter, consider the following key features:

  • Compatibility: Ensure the adapter supports your vehicle’s make, model, and year.
  • Bluetooth Version: Opt for adapters with Bluetooth 4.0 or higher for faster and more stable connections.
  • Supported Protocols: Check if the adapter supports all OBD2 protocols (CAN, ISO, PWM, VPW, KWP2000).
  • Firmware Version: Newer firmware versions often include bug fixes and improved performance.
  • Software Compatibility: Verify that the adapter works with your preferred diagnostic apps.

11.2 Wired vs. Wireless Adapters

OBD2 adapters come in wired and wireless versions, each offering distinct advantages:

  • Wired Adapters: Provide a stable and reliable connection, ideal for advanced diagnostics and reprogramming. They connect via USB, ensuring consistent data transfer.
  • Wireless Adapters: Offer convenience and flexibility, allowing you to move freely while monitoring data. They connect via Bluetooth or Wi-Fi, making them suitable for real-time data logging and quick diagnostics.

11.3 Understanding Bluetooth Compatibility

Bluetooth compatibility is essential for wireless OBD2 adapters. Ensure that the adapter supports the Bluetooth version of your smartphone or tablet. Newer Bluetooth versions offer better range, faster data transfer, and improved security.

14.1 What is the Default PIN for Most ELM327 OBD2 Adapters?

The default PIN for most ELM327 OBD2 adapters is often 1234 or 0000.

14.2 Can I Use an ELM327 Adapter on Any Car?

While ELM327 adapters are designed to work with any OBD2 compliant vehicle (most cars made after 1996), compatibility can vary. Always check the adapter’s specifications to ensure it supports your vehicle’s make and model.

14.3 What If My Device Is Not Discovering the OBD2 Adapter?

Ensure the adapter is properly plugged into the OBD2 port, and the ignition is turned on. Also, verify that Bluetooth is enabled on your device and that the adapter is within range.

14.4 How Do I Update the Firmware on My ELM327 Adapter?

Firmware updates are typically done through a specific app provided by the adapter manufacturer. Check the manufacturer’s website for instructions and the latest firmware version.

14.5 Is It Safe to Leave the OBD2 Adapter Plugged In All the Time?

While it’s generally safe, leaving the adapter plugged in can drain the car’s battery over time, especially if the car is not driven regularly. It’s best to unplug the adapter when not in use.

14.6 What Are the Most Common Issues Diagnosed with an OBD2 Adapter?

Common issues include engine misfires, oxygen sensor faults, and emission control problems.

14.7 Can I Unlock Hidden Features on My Car with an ELM327 Adapter?

Yes, but this depends on your car’s make and model, as well as the software you use. Research thoroughly and proceed with caution to avoid causing issues.

14.8 What Should I Do If I Enter the Wrong PIN Multiple Times?

If you enter the wrong PIN multiple times, the adapter may lock you out temporarily. Try again after a few minutes or consult the adapter’s documentation for reset instructions.

14.9 Will Using an OBD2 Adapter Void My Car’s Warranty?

Using an OBD2 adapter for basic diagnostics typically does not void your warranty. However, modifying your car’s settings or unlocking hidden features may void certain warranty aspects.
